  1. i don't know how to maken a 2 part vcd file with ulead dvd workshop, can someone explain to me or tell where i can find info.

    What i want is:
    from a dvd file captured with wintv pvr250 or a svcd/vcd file making 2 mpeg vcd files with chapters and menu's. I know that i can do this with "cut title" and "trim" mark in and mark out but i don't know how i do this. What is the difference between mark in and mark out and title cut?
    Must i burn a title and then the other title on another cd? Must i make chapters for both titles? or do i need only one title and split the dvd file of vcd file another way?


    Which is the order to make two mpeg files for 2 cdr's with chapters and a menu? and how?

  2. Hi, I suggest dowmnloading the manual from Ulead site. Page 40 to 48 deal with this issue. But basically what you do is drag the clip from the Library ( on left in Edit panel ) onto a placeholder ( bottom section of edit panel ). Ensure this is highlighted and play the video to the point where you want to make a break then click on the "Cut Title" icon. This will put 3 movies in the placeholder section. One will be the whole movie, One the first part of the seperated movie and the 3rd the last part of the seperated movie. You can find out which is which by doubleclicking on each and watching the length of the green line under the preview window. If you want just the two parts, delete the whole one, then go on to the menu section. You can of course break it up more if you want.
